About

Rebecca Bertolio is a scholar working on Molecular Biology, Cell Biology and Cancer Research. According to data from OpenAlex, Rebecca Bertolio has authored 4 papers receiving a total of 467 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Molecular Biology, 3 papers in Cell Biology and 2 papers in Cancer Research. Recurrent topics in Rebecca Bertolio's work include Cancer, Hypoxia, and Metabolism (2 papers), Hippo pathway signaling and YAP/TAZ (2 papers) and Protein Kinase Regulation and GTPase Signaling (1 paper). Rebecca Bertolio is often cited by papers focused on Cancer, Hypoxia, and Metabolism (2 papers), Hippo pathway signaling and YAP/TAZ (2 papers) and Protein Kinase Regulation and GTPase Signaling (1 paper). Rebecca Bertolio collaborates with scholars based in Italy, Portugal and Switzerland. Rebecca Bertolio's co-authors include Giannino Del Sal, Miguel Mano, Giovanni Sorrentino, Silvio Bicciato, Alessandro Zannini, Francesco Napoletano, Marco Fantuz, Sebastian Maurer‐Stroh, Antonio Rosato and Elisa Cappuzzello and has published in prestigious journals such as Nature Communications, Nature Cell Biology and Current Opinion in Cell Biology.
